Transaction 89318075c93c63411446b3f3a0349fcde7dd2307d5233ea1da60a101107ab038
1 Input
1 Output
-
89318075c93c63411446b3f3a0349fcde7dd2307d5233ea1da60a101107ab038:0
- value
- 49978340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 486d64715ac92638fa482928e7263610534318b2 OP_EQUAL
- address
- 38Hyd4zNTH1fMZoUy4XMxPMSP9iW3Pf6yN